The Shift Towards User-Centric Authentication in Online Gambling
Historically, online casino login procedures were often cumbersome, with minimal security features. Over time, unfortunate breaches and identity frauds highlighted the necessity for more secure authentication processes, aligning with global standards like AML (Anti-Money Laundering) and KYC (Know Your Customer) regulations. These regulatory frameworks have driven the industry to innovate login solutions, emphasizing security without compromising user experience.
Modern platforms now leverage multi-factor authentication (MFA), biometric verification, and secure encryption protocols to verify user identities reliably. This evolution ensures confidence among players that their personal information and funds are protected against cyber threats—a non-negotiable aspect in regulatory-compliant markets such as Australia.

Infrastructural Innovations: From Traditional to Next-Gen Authentication
Advancements in technology have introduced various methods to enhance login security. For example, biometric authentication—using fingerprint or facial recognition—has become increasingly prevalent, lending both convenience and confidence to users. Additionally, token-based MFA, often combining SMS codes with app-generated one-time passwords, substantially reduces account compromise risk.
Particularly in regulated markets like Australia, integrating these technologies aligns with laws aimed at minimizing problem gambling and fraudulent activity. The industry’s commitment to innovation is evidenced by collaborations with cybersecurity firms that focus on adaptive security protocols, making unauthorized access exceedingly difficult.
